SKLN Series Counterflow Cooler
SKLN jerin reverse kwararar sanyaya
Features
1. The counterflow cooling principle is adopted to cool the pellets with high temperature and moisture. Hot air touches hot pellets and cool air touches cool pellets so as to avoid the pellet surface crack caused by sudden cooling produced by direct touching between cool air and hot pellets. At the same time, the airlock is used for feeding and space of air inlet bigger, therefore it can get better cooling effects;
2.Slide reciprocating discharger has smooth and reliable discharging, low residue;
3.Low power consumption, ease of operation;
4.Pellet temperature after cooling is less than +3°C~5°C ambient temperature;
5. Capable of cooling pellets.
